Bugis cuisine, originating with the Bugis folks in South Sulawesi, Indonesia, is noted for its loaded flavors and diverse components. The strategy of halal food stuff is central to this culinary custom, ensuring that all foods adhere to Islamic dietary regulations. Listed here’s a detailed overview:

Critical Attributes of Bugis Halal Foods
Halal Principles

Permissible Substances: All components should be halal (lawful), this means they don't include any prohibited substances such as pork or Liquor.
Slaughtering Methods: Animals needs to be slaughtered In keeping with Islamic tips (Zabiha) to make certain their meat is halal.
Cultural Influences

The Bugis culture has actually been motivated by various ethnic groups because of trade and migration, incorporating things from Javanese, Chinese, and Arabic cuisines.
Standard spices and herbs are used extensively to improve flavor.
Popular Components

Rice: A staple food stuff typically served with numerous dishes.
Fish: Freshwater fish like tilapia or shrimp are well-liked because of their abundance in regional waters.
Vegetables: Several different vegetables like spinach, eggplant, and beans are generally A part of meals.
Cooking Procedures

Grilling: A lot of dishes are grilled over charcoal for the smoky taste.
Stewing: Slow-cooked stews make it possible for flavors to meld beautifully.
Frying: Deep-frying is prevalent for snacks and facet dishes.
Well-known Bugis Halal Dishes
Coto Makassar: A savory beef soup enriched with spices; served with rice cakes or rice.
Sop Saudara: A hearty beef broth made up of noodles and vegetables; flavorful nevertheless light-weight within the palate.
Pallu Basa: Spicy fish stew built with new capture simmered in coconut milk and spices; ordinarily appreciated with steamed rice.
Snacks & Desserts
Kue Cubir: Sweet rice flour cake stuffed with palm sugar; a pleasant treat typically relished in the course of gatherings.
Klepon: get more info Glutinous rice balls stuffed with sweetened palm sugar coated in grated coconut; great for snacking.
Consuming Etiquette
Serving Buy

Foods ordinarily start with prayer ahead of intake as an indication of gratitude.
Sharing Foods

It’s customary to share meals amid family members or visitors being a gesture of hospitality.
Working with Arms

In conventional options, taking in with palms is most popular—Particularly using the appropriate hand only—since it signifies regard toward the food.
